TCG (short for "The Cheetah Girls") is the official debut studio album (second studio overall, including Cheetah-licious Christmas) studio album of The Cheetah Girls. The album was released on Hollywood Records on September 25, 2007.
The Girls began work on the album while touring the U.S. on their The Party's Just Begun Tour which began in September 2006 and ended in March 2007.
Group member Adrienne Bailon was quoted as saying, "We'll be making a real studio album, not a soundtrack. It's important for people to see us as a real musical group. We have all this great marketing around us, with the movies and other things. But we are a musical group." She also added that the soundtracks and Christmas album "don't count".
